2020 BOB to PYG Historical Review
A comprehensive breakdown of exchange rate performance throughout the year 2020.
2020 BOB to PYG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2020
During 2020, the BOB to PYG ex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 11, valuing the pair at 1024.4559.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 12, dropping to 934.2942.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 90.1617 PYG.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 941.1302 to the December average rate of 1009.0296, the exchange rate registered a net change of 7.21% (reflecting a strengthening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2020 high of 1024.4559 was up 9.07% compared to the 2019 peak of 939.2530,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 944.1589 | 934.5696 | 941.1302 |
| February | 947.2709 | 937.3958 | 943.4623 |
| March | 964.6948 | 939.8540 | 953.2476 |
| April | 951.9035 | 934.2942 | 943.6683 |
| May | 962.7963 | 944.4570 | 953.0314 |
| June | 984.3718 | 961.8343 | 969.9836 |
| July | 1009.2689 | 985.1377 | 997.6042 |
| August | 1013.3183 | 1001.9476 | 1006.8345 |
| September | 1014.7961 | 1007.3219 | 1011.1345 |
| October | 1020.3122 | 1011.5768 | 1016.0023 |
| November | 1022.4072 | 1015.1409 | 1019.8484 |
| December | 1024.4559 | 978.0677 | 1009.0296 |
